Julian Lampkin

Julian Lampkin, 100, of New Britain passed away on Monday, May 30 at home, peacefully with family by his side.  Born in Appling, GA, he was the son of the late William and Elizabeth Lampkin.  Mr. Lampkin has lived in New Britain since 1945 when he was honorably discharged from the Army.  He served honorably in the military of the U.S. of America and received a certificate of award as a testimonial of honest and faithful service to this country.  Mr. Lampkin was a WWII veteran and served as a MP (Military Police).  He was discharged December 1945.  Mr. Lampkin was formerly employed at Stanley Works, before retiring.  He also had his own moving business to help supplement his income.  Mr. Lampkin was a faithful member of Grace Community Church, formerly known as McCullough Temple CME in New Britain, CT.
